Govt and JI agree to form committees to recommend petroleum levy reduction

HarZaviya summary · from 6 outlets

Most outlets led with the agreement between the federal government and Jamaat-i-Islami Pakistan to form committees for recommending petroleum levy reductions. Dawn and Aaj News included the name of JI's Emir, Hafiz Naeemur Rehman, in their excerpts, while Pakistan Observer omitted it. Business Recorder added context about rising inflation and petroleum prices as a backdrop to the agreement. All excerpts framed the move as aimed at providing public relief.

  1. Government, JI agree to hold talks on petroleum prices, inflation relief

    Federal Minister for Planning Ahsan Iqbal has said that the government and Jamaat-e-Islami (JI) agreed to form committees to discuss ways to provide relief to the public. Speaking at a joint press conference in Lahore on Thursday along with JI Emir Hafiz Naeemur Rehman and Prime Minister’s Adviser on Political Affairs Rana Sanaullah, Iqbal said […]
